Smoke reported near warehouse, fire units respondEaston PA

audio iconFire & Arson
Near Lehigh Dr, Easton, PA 18042

Firefighters responded to a report of smoke near Lehigh Drive, close to a warehouse that previously burned. They investigated a possible dumpster fire and used a drone to survey the area while applying water to the fire.
